Something else to try is to very lightly rub or brush a tiny bit of very light or light frosted powder eyeshadow over the creed and number, then carefully wipe off the excess so that the light powder stays inside the stamped numbers and letters but not on the higher unstamped leather. That might highlight the stamping enough to be able to read and photograph it.
